Mesothelioma Attorneys

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ims and their families access compensation from asbestos trust funds. Companies that produce asbestos-containing products have set aside billions of dollars.

Lawyers can aid victims through the entire legal process, beginning with identifying potential exposure sites and ending with filing a lawsuit. A national firm will be able to understand state statutes of limitations and ensure that clients do not miss their deadlines.

Legal help for mesothelioma can be crucial in fighting the aggressive cancer. Asbestos victims are often left with high medical costs and limited life expectancy, which makes mesothelioma compensation a crucial method of paying for treatment. Compensation may cover the loss of wages, travel expenses to treatment, or even support for family members.

A person suffering from mesothelioma may seek compensation for their losses or death through a personal injury lawsuit. These claims can be filed against the asbestos companies responsible for the victim's exposure. In the past, a lot of mesothelioma case victims filed class-action lawsuits. These kinds of claims have been less popular in recent years because they tend to provide victims with lower compensation.

A mesothelioma attorney can also help veterans file VA benefits for mesothelioma. Compensation from the VA can be used to cover mesothelioma treatments, caregiver costs, and other expenses. Mesothelioma is a fatal cancer is caused by exposure to asbestos.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ral. Asbestos is used in many everyday consumer products, including insulation, fireproofing products, and ceiling tiles. Exposure to asbestos can cause various health issues, such as respiratory diseases and mesothelioma. Mesothelioma can develop decades after exposure to asbestos.

Asbestos-related victims could be eligible for substantial compensation to cover the cost of future and past medical expenses. The money could be used to cover the cost of life-altering treatments like chemotherapy or surgery, as well as other costly procedures. Compensation may also be offered for pain and suffering, and other kinds of damages.

If a mesothelioma patient dies and their immediate family members or estate representatives may file a lawsuit for wrongful death against asbestos companies that were negligent in exposing the victim asbestos. The money resulting from this lawsuit can be used to pay for funeral costs as well as financial and emotional costs, and future loss of income.

Many asbestos-related companies have declared bankruptcy, and some have established trusts in bankruptcy for people suffering from asbestos-related diseases. A mesothelioma attorney with experience is aware of how to use the trust funds to obtain the compensation you deserve. They will also draft the necessary paperwork and submit them to the appropriate trustees. They will then follow up to ensure that your bankruptcy claim is dealt with quickly.
